[99] vmnetcfg 操作虛擬網卡相關資訊

資料通訊與網路-課程版面-授課教授:XO

版主: b80203, ghost3401, XO, maa, siegf

分享到: Facebook

[99] vmnetcfg 操作虛擬網卡相關資訊

文章XO » 週五 10月 22, 2010 2:05 pm

聽說今天實習,助教已經教大家如何從 VMware Player 安裝檔裡去 extractvmnetcfg.exe 這個工具。
用它去為座落在 192.168.202.128 這個 Private IP 上的 B2D Linux Server 做 NAT 相關設定。

似乎在設定 Port Forwarding 過程中以及設定完,進一步使用實體 IP 從外頭透過 SSH Secure Client
進來到 B2D 虛擬機裡時,遭遇困難... 我把站上前此一些與這問題有關的討論找出來,彙編於此,看看可不可
以收到 鑑往知來 之效!

果有疏漏... 歡迎「眼尖同學」補完一下囉... ^o^

  1. [99] 我說 vmnetcfg 跑哪兒去了,原來... - 說明 VMware Player V3.0 版以後,這個工具預設不會
    安裝,需要自行去安裝檔 Extract 出來用。
  2. [97] VMware NAT/DHCP 服務開啟 - 輔大電腦教室SF338裡的機器,預設這兩個服務是關閉的,須
    手動打開。
  3. [98] B2D連不上SSH - 連不上有諸多原因,這個討論串提到的下一篇,就是今天課堂上實習時,Port
    Forwarding 完成後,無法從外面 ssh 連入到 b2d 的原因。
  4. [98] 終於讓我連上去啦!!!哈哈 - b2d 預設防火牆的設定,ssh 連線需要來自與 b2d 同一網段的電腦才
    予以放行,如要放寬這個限制的話,需到 /etc/init.d/rc.local 裡作設定。
  5. [98] B2D的問題 - 這位同學原來在家裝 VMWare Player 時,VMNet8 是被賦予在 192.168.52.0 這
    個網段 (其實每次安裝,VMNet1 與 VMNet8都會以亂數產生器賦予網段編號,所以當然不會與教室的
    192.168.234.0 相同),結果這位同學透過 b2d 內部操作把 eth0 第一張網卡以 Static IP 方式設成與
    學校教室的一樣的 192.168.2.234.128,後來發現不對,又用 vmnetcfg.exe 工具把 VMNet8 的網
    段也調成 192.168.234.0。這時裡外皆可以互通,但 ssh 連線受阻,問題出在調過網路的網段,b2d 防
    火牆裡 iptables 的設定,卻沒有配合作調整所致。
  6. [98] 電腦教室 BS302 DHCP 問題 - 這裡有 Host Only 搭配 Windows ICS 連外遭遇的問題與解決過
    程的討論。
  7. [98][問題] VMware網卡問題
  8. ...


(未完... 有事走開... 待續... 同學可以補強的說...)
最後由 XO 於 週二 3月 15, 2011 6:34 pm 編輯,總共編輯了 18 次。
eXtra Old 的是我「不是酒」哦!
제 이름은 오조휘 입니다

臉書裡依舊是 Extra.Old: http://www.facebook.com/extra.old
頭像
XO
資管系教師
 
文章: 5331
註冊時間: 週二 4月 27, 2004 12:20 pm
來自: CQ Inc.

Re:[99] vmnetcfg 操作虛擬網卡相關資訊

文章ghost3401 » 週五 10月 22, 2010 2:44 pm

vm 教學

我看這篇依樣畫葫蘆作了上百遍 :D
ghost3401
繼續深造的研究生
 
文章: 473
註冊時間: 週四 9月 07, 2006 9:07 am
來自: 基隆偏遠地帶

Re:[99] vmnetcfg 操作虛擬網卡相關資訊

文章XO » 週五 10月 22, 2010 5:46 pm

今天上課指引大家參考 [95] 看圖說 Proxy 的故事 這一篇四年前在 LE403 教室實作時,VMware 網路設定的圖解說明...
(贅述如下)

圖檔

剛剛站裡搜尋了一翻,看到這郭去年在 BS302 的設置... (詳 [98] 電腦教室 BS302 DHCP 問題 這一篇) 畫得更為貼切...
我把它略做調整成為今年 ([99] 學年度) SF338 教室 DC 課程的設置如下:

註:Well,... 裡頭 Host Only 這 VMNet1 的網段被我改到 192.168.0.0... 是為了搭配 Windows 裡的 ICS - Internet
Connection Sharing / 「網際網路連線共用」機制使用的,VMNet8 裡的 NAT 是 VMWare 以 Windows 服務方式模擬
出來的 NAT Server。ICS 則是 Windows XP 內建的 NAT 服務。

此外這張圖去年實習時,我為 B2D 虛擬機多加了張虛擬網卡,讓他也接到 Host Only 這個網路,另外還開了一台 DSL -
Damn Small Linux 虛擬機。DSL 虛擬機圖上畫了兩個連外機制,一個是在 Host Only 網路上,經由 VMNet1 透過
Windows 的「網際網路連線共用」連外,另一種則是採「橋接 (Bridge)」模式直接連外。


圖檔

(原稿 PowerPoint 夾檔於後供同學享用,如要轉載請註明出處,順便幫咱們這個版打打廣告,這是我 XO 辛苦創作出來的唷。)

咱們課本 (陳祥輝 著「新思維網路概論 (Introduction to Computer Networks)」2010/6 初版) 第三章的 圖3-22 VMware
軟體的網路架構圖
也畫得蠻棒的... 參照著看唄!

圖檔
附加檔案
SF338VMwareNetSetup.ppt
SF338 教室 VMware Player 網路配置
(163.5 KiB) 被下載 387 次
eXtra Old 的是我「不是酒」哦!
제 이름은 오조휘 입니다

臉書裡依舊是 Extra.Old: http://www.facebook.com/extra.old
頭像
XO
資管系教師
 
文章: 5331
註冊時間: 週二 4月 27, 2004 12:20 pm
來自: CQ Inc.

Re:[99] vmnetcfg 操作虛擬網卡相關資訊

文章XO » 週二 3月 15, 2011 3:10 pm

頂一下本學年 上學期 輔大資管「資料通訊與網路」課程的這一篇討論串。
這學年下學期 輔大資管的「Web程式設計」 淡大工學院的「動態網頁系統設計」兩課程實習環境雷同,
這篇討論都可以援用...

只不過 淡大 E213 教室的 VMWare 虛擬網路設置換成下面這一張:

圖檔

這個討論串裡有關 VMWare NAT 以及 DHCP 這兩項 Windows 服務在輔大電腦教室需要手動開啟,這是
因為輔大資訊中心為了節省不必要的電腦資源耗費,這兩項服務唯有在需要開啟 VMWare 虛擬機前,再啟動
即可。淡大 E213 教室,安裝完 VMware Player 的 XP 預設這兩項服務是開啟著,並沒有被關閉。

對於虛擬機的操作同學需要學會:

  1. 開啟 及 關閉 虛擬機
  2. 開啟後 動態 IP 的重新取得
  3. 取得新的 IP 之後,伺服器統一管理密碼及防火牆的重新設定
  4. 在 B2D 虛擬機裡開啟 終端機 視窗
  5. 用 ifconfig、ping 來確認網路連線運作正常否
  6. 用 netstat、grep 指令來確認各伺服器是否如預期正常開啟並處於 Listen 狀態
  7. 從外頭透過 SSH Secure Client 做安全性終端機遠端連線登入,下指令
  8. 透過 SSH 的 FTP 機制,對 B2D Linux Server 做檔案上傳下載。


另外 輔大資管 這學期 由於 配合 另一門 網管課程,SF338 教室的 VMWare Player 3, 改成 VMWare Server V1。
有關 vmnetcfg.exe 這支公用程式,預設安裝就內含,無須像此討論串所提,需要額外去安裝檔裡 Extract ... 但
要留意的是... vmnetcfg.exe 這兩個版本使用介面有蠻大幅度的變更。VMWware Server V1 這舊版的 vmnetcfg
介面長得比較像這篇舊討論:http://eoffice.im.fju.edu.tw/phpbb/viewtopic.php?p=10123#10123
eXtra Old 的是我「不是酒」哦!
제 이름은 오조휘 입니다

臉書裡依舊是 Extra.Old: http://www.facebook.com/extra.old
頭像
XO
資管系教師
 
文章: 5331
註冊時間: 週二 4月 27, 2004 12:20 pm
來自: CQ Inc.


回到 資料通訊與網路

誰在線上

正在瀏覽這個版面的使用者:沒有註冊會員 和 0 位訪客

cron